Square-profile cutting line for petrol and electric strimmers. Made from tough plastic resistant to breaking and abrasion.
Four sharp cutting edges increase the cutting surface compared with round line. The square profile cuts dense grass and young shrub shoots more efficiently thanks to its more aggressive cutting action.
A medium diameter suitable for most petrol strimmers rated 0.7–1.2 kW. It balances durability against engine load. Ideal for cutting medium-density grass and clearing weeds.
A material resistant to bending, stretching and breaking. Increased abrasion resistance extends the working life of the line in demanding conditions – on contact with stones, kerbs and fences.
Enough for several refills in an automatic or bump-feed head. At typical wear rates it lasts around 3–5 seasons of use in a domestic garden of up to 500 m².

Before buying, check the maximum line diameter in your strimmer's manual. 1.6 mm is standard for petrol units above 0.7 kW and for most electric strimmers above 500 W. On automatic heads, check the maximum line diameter – it is usually 2.0–2.4 mm.
On bump-feed heads, wind the line onto the spool by hand following the direction of the arrows, leaving around 10–15 cm of free ends. On automatic heads, simply feed a length of line through the eyelets and press the button – the spool winds itself. Once fitted, check that both ends are of similar length (around 12–15 cm).
During use the line wears down gradually through abrasion against the ground and contact with hard obstacles. Check the length of the ends regularly – when they shorten to 5–8 cm, feed more line out or replace the spool.
Store the line in a dry place, away from direct sunlight. Plastic can lose its flexibility and become brittle under UV light. Store at temperatures between 5 and 25°C.
Avoid working in areas with lots of stones and rubble – this accelerates line wear and increases the risk of breakage. When trimming along hard edges (concrete, metal), reduce the trimmer's speed to limit abrasion.
